Staff Software Engineer, Data Engineering Solutions
Seattle, WA - USA
Job Summary
Who we are
About Stripe
Stripe is a financial infrastructure platform for businesses. Millions of companiesfrom the worlds largest enterprises to the most ambitious startupsuse Stripe to accept payments grow their revenue and accelerate new business opportunities. Our mission is to increase the GDP of the internet and we have a staggering amount of work ahead. That means you have an unprecedented opportunity to put the global economy within everyones reach while doing the most important work of your career.
About the team
We are experts in data working to make it cost-effective understandable and trustworthy. We build pipelines processing billions of events a day and are stewards of canonical data warehouses and datasets delivering products for Stripe Users while embedding with teams to build their data products. We are experts in using the Stripe Data Platform and to scale we lead the data culture and data education to enable product teams to own their data. We invest in AI-driven Data Ops to scale incident handling and serve as an escalation path for data incidents to minimize their impact. The Data Engineering Solutions team will work closely with product teams delivering trustworthy data / backend code / and innovative AI tools/platforms/services for data.
What youll do
Were looking for a person who could drive the Data Engineering Solutions team in solving high-impact cutting-edge data problems. The ideal candidate will be someone that has built data pipelines for large scale volume is deeply knowledgeable of key tools including Airflow/Spark/Kafka/Flink is empathetic excels at building strong relationships and collaborates effectively with other Stripe teams to understand their use cases and unlock new capabilities.
Responsibilities
- Lead the technical outcomes for a team of ambitious talented engineers providing mentorship guidance and support to ensure their success
- Partner with our recruiting team to attract and hire top talent
- Deliver cutting-edge data pipelines that scale to users needs focusing on reliability and efficiency
- Develop strong subject matter expertise and manage the SLAs of data pipelines and full stack web applications that support critical stakeholders
- Collaborate with product managers and peers across the company to create/improve canonical datasets and data warehouses use golden paths and ensure Stripes and customers are using trustworthy data
- Leverage AI/LLM and Agents at scale to produce and analyze high-quality data on ambiguous problems
- Have the opportunity to drive the execution of key data initiatives for Stripe overseeing the entire development lifecycle from planning to delivery while maintaining high standards of quality and timely completion
- Foster a collaborative and inclusive work environment promoting innovation knowledge sharing and continuous improvement within the team
Who you are
Were looking for someone who meets the minimum requirements to be considered for the role. If you meet these requirements you are encouraged to apply. The preferred qualifications are a bonus not a requirement.
Minimum requirements
- This is a Staff-level role that typically means 10 years of experience building and operating data systems pipelines warehouses infrastructure and leading teams to deliver exceptional solutions
- A strong engineering background and passion for data as well as prior experience with writing and debugging data pipelines using a distributed data framework
- An inquisitive nature in diving into data inconsistencies to pinpoint issues and resolve deep rooted data quality issues
- Knowledge of a backend development language (such as Scala Java or Go) and strong SQL experience
- Extreme customer focus with a commitment to partnering with product leaders across the business and other Stripe engineers to understand their use cases
- Effective cross-functional collaboration with the ability to think rigorously communicate clearly and make or coordinate difficult decisions and trade-offs
- Thrive with high autonomy and responsibility in an ambiguous environment
- Ability to foster and work in a healthy inclusive challenging and supportive work environment
Preferred qualifications
- Our stack is made up of Iceberg Kafka Change Data Capture Flink Spark Airflow Hive Metastore Pinot Trino AWS Cloud - experience with all or some of these tools is a huge plus
- Influencing open-source contributions is a huge plus
- Experience creating and maintaining data marts / warehouses to power business reporting needs
- Experience collaborating with Product Go-To-Market or Sales / Marketing teams
- Genuine enjoyment of innovation and a deep interest in understanding how things work with the ability to question and direct architectural decisions
- Strong written and verbal communication skills for various audiences including leadership users and company-wide
Required Experience:
Staff IC
About Company
Stripe is a suite of APIs powering online payment processing and commerce solutions for internet businesses of all sizes. Accept payments and scale faster with AI.